Dear All, I have tried to plot graphs of one row of four figures for each station. In each graph, black points indicate data in the year of 2002, denoted as Y2002, whereas grey points indicate data in the year of 2014, denoted as Y2014. I ended up with 2x2 plots with all data points in black. Can anyone find out what has gone wrong by any chance please?
Raw<-structure(list(Date = structure(c(6L, 7L, 2L, 4L, 12L, 9L, 7L, 2L, 4L, 12L, 6L, 15L, 14L, 3L, 6L, 1L, 16L, 5L, 11L, 8L, 4L, 10L, 13L, 6L, 1L, 16L, 5L, 11L, 8L, 4L, 10L, 13L, 6L, 1L, 16L, 5L, 11L, 8L, 4L, 10L, 13L, 11L, 8L, 4L, 10L, 13L), .Label = c("1/10", "1/11", "11/11", "12/11", "13/10", "19/9", "2/10", "2/11", "20/9", "26/11", "29/10", "29/11", "30/11", "31/10", "4/10", "6/10"), class = "factor"), Year = structure(c(1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L), .Label = c("Y2002", "Y2014"), class = "factor"), Station = structure(c(1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 1L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 2L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 3L, 4L, 4L, 4L, 4L, 4L), .Label = c("E", "F", "H", "I" ), class = "factor"), Abun = c(3.42, 1.33, 3.67, 3.67, 3.92, 2.17, 2.5, 1.67, 6.33, 0.67, 1, 1, 1.33, 2.08, 0, 0, 0.33, 0.08, 0.08, 0, 0.5, 0.17, 0.67, 0.67, 0, 1, 0.58, 1.5, 2.67, 0.67, 1.33, 3, 0.58, 1.17, 1.25, 0.75, 1.25, 1.75, 0.92, 1.5, 0.83, 0.75, 2.33, 0.67, 1.33, 1.58), Date1 = structure(c(16697, 16710, 16740, 16751, 16768, 16698, 16710, 16740, 16751, 16768, 16697, 16712, 16739, 16750, 16697, 16709, 16714, 16721, 16737, 16741, 16751, 16765, 16769, 16697, 16709, 16714, 16721, 16737, 16741, 16751, 16765, 16769, 16697, 16709, 16714, 16721, 16737, 16741, 16751, 16765, 16769, 16737, 16741, 16751, 16765, 16769 ), class = "Date")), .Names = c("Date", "Year", "Station", "Abun", "Date1"), row.names = c(NA, -46L), class = "data.frame") Raw$Date1<-as.Date(Raw$Date,"%d/%m") library(lattice) par(mfrow=c(1,4)) culr<-ifelse(Raw$Year=="Y2002","Black","Grey") xyplot(Abun~Date1|Station,Raw,type="p",xlab=list("Month",cex=1.5),ylab=list("Abundance",cex=1.5),cex=2,pch=16,col=culr,strip=strip.custom(bg='white')) Many thanks.
